Как работают хранилища данных и машины

Как работают хранилища данных и машины

Нынешние цифровые сервисы работают благодаря связи двух основных частей. Машины обрабатывают обращения пользователей и осуществляют расчеты. Хранилища данных хранят сведения в упорядоченном виде. Постижение принципов работы помогает понять в механизмах функционирования 1вин казино цифровых систем и программ.

Почему за каждым ресурсом и программой скрывается невидимая структура

Юзеры наблюдают только оболочку программы или сайта. За графической оболочкой находится запутанная техническая организация. Серверное техника находится в дата-центрах и поддерживает бесперебойную работу системы. Хранилища хранения информации включают миллионы сведений о пользователях, операциях и содержимом.

Архитектура исполняет критически важные задачи. Она обрабатывает поступающие обращения от тысяч юзеров одновременно. Компоненты платформы верифицируют разрешения входа и оберегают конфиденциальную информацию. 1вин синхронизирует сотрудничество между различными компонентами сервиса. Без устойчивой инженерной фундамента нельзя построить надёжный виртуальный продукт.

Что такое сервер и зачем он требуется виртуальному сервису

Сервер является собой машину с большой скоростью, который обслуживает требования клиентских гаджетов. Программное обеспечение управляет входом к средствам и распределяет трафик. 1вин ответственен за механизмы деятельности приложения и связь с базами сведений. Без серверной части недостижима функционирование нынешних веб-сервисов.

Как база данных сохраняет сведения и позволяет моментально ее обнаруживать

Хранилище данных упорядочивает данные в таблицы, файлы или схемы. Упорядоченное размещение позволяет оперативно извлекать нужные записи. 1win casino использует специальные механизмы для улучшения доступа к сведениям.

Производительность деятельности обеспечивается разными инструментами:

  • Индексы генерируют указатели на часто требуемые данные
  • Кэширование записывает востребованные требования в буфере
  • Партиционирование разделяет крупные таблицы сегменты фрагменты
  • Репликация дублирует информацию на несколько машин

Корректная архитектура базы сокращает период отклика и увеличивает эффективность программы.

Что совершается, когда юзер открывает портал или приложение

Пользовательское устройство отправляет запрос на машину через сеть. Запрос включает данные о требуемой странице или команде. Сервер изучает запрос и устанавливает нужные информацию для ответа.

Платформа запрашивает к базе для получения нужных сведений. 1win casino выполняет поиск по указанным критериям и предоставляет данные. Машина обрабатывает сведения и создаёт HTML-страницу или JSON-ответ. Готовый итог доставляется на устройство юзера. Браузер или программа отображает данные на дисплее. Весь процесс требует фрагменты секунды при правильной конфигурации.

Связь между сервером, базой данных и пользовательским интерфейсом

Пользовательский оболочка составляет внешнюю сторону сервиса. Кнопки и формы передают команды на серверную компонент. Машина выступает мостом между юзером и репозиторием сведений. Он принимает обращения и формирует обращения к данным.

1вин казино извлекает нужную данные из таблиц. Машина преобразует данные в структуру для пользовательского сервиса. Сведения передаются в интерфейс для вывода. Трёхслойная структура распределяет обязанности между элементами. Такое разделение облегчает создание и сопровождение решения. Каждый компонент обновляется автономно от остальных элементов.

Почему данные необходимо не только содержать, а грамотно структурировать

Неструктурированное хранение сведений ведёт к низкой функционированию системы. Выборка требуемой информации среди миллионов компонентов занимает существенное время. Корректная организация ускоряет вход и снижает нагрузку на технику.

Нормализация устраняет повторение и экономит дисковое объём. Связи между таблицами гарантируют сохранность информации. 1вин казино поддерживает непротиворечивость данных при одновременных изменениях. Индексирование главных атрибутов формирует быстрые пути получения. Качественная организация базы увеличивает устойчивость и скорость всего сервиса.

Реляционные и нереляционные базы данных: в чем отличие на реальности

Реляционные платформы упорядочивают информацию в таблицы со жёсткой структурой. Связи между таблицами гарантируют сохранность информации. Язык SQL даёт осуществлять запутанные команды и соединять данные из множественных баз.

Нереляционные решения применяют динамические форматы организации. Документоориентированные решения хранят сведения в JSON-структурах. Графовые хранилища оптимизированы для работы со связями между элементами.

1вин выбирается в соответствии от запросов проекта. Реляционные годятся для операционных систем с строгой схемой. Нереляционные гарантируют расширяемость и пластичность схемы сведений.

Как команды позволяют получать требуемую информацию из базы

Обращения являются собой директивы для извлечения или изменения данных. Язык SQL даёт формулировать условия отбора и фильтрации данных. Платформа определяет наилучший путь исполнения команды.

Ключевые типы действий с сведениями:

  • Отбор данных по заданным условиям
  • Внесение дополнительных элементов в таблицы
  • Модификация существующих данных
  • Ликвидация неактуальной данных

1win casino ускоряет выполнение запросов с посредством индексов. Составные запросы объединяют данные из нескольких таблиц. Групповые методы определяют итоги и усреднённые значения. Грамотно составленные обращения ускоряют получение результатов.

Функция API в передаче сведениями между системами

API представляет программный протокол для сотрудничества между платформами. Интерфейс устанавливает принципы взаимодействия сведениями и схемы передачи сведений. Системы используют API для доступа функциональности внешних программ.

REST API работает через HTTP-протокол и задействует стандартные способы команд. Пользователь посылает обращение с параметрами. Машина выполняет запрос и возвращает результат в структуре JSON. 1вин казино выдаёт информацию через API для внешних программ.

Механизмы позволяют интегрировать расчётные системы, карты и общественные платформы. Инженеры разрабатывают модульные программы с взаимодействием через API. Такой метод ускоряет масштабирование системы.

Почему производительность сервера влияет на работу всего сервиса

Длительность отклика сервера задаёт темп загрузки страниц и исполнения команд. Низкая обработка запросов понижает результативность. Каждая лишняя секунда ожидания повышает долю уходов.

Скорость техники воздействует на объём одновременно выполняемых обращений. Слабая мощность процессора порождает очереди и задержки. Оперативная ОЗУ лимитирует объем буферизуемых информации.

Доработка алгоритмов улучшает эффективность работы. Производительный машина обеспечивает удобное использование с программой. Эффективность инфраструктуры сказывается на лояльность пользователей и успешность сервиса.

Как серверы обрабатывают с большим количеством клиентов

Расширение пользователей создает усиленную нагрузку на систему. Единственный машина не может обслуживать миллионы обращений синхронно. Платформы используют различные подходы для разделения трафика.

Горизонтальное расширение включает добавочные серверы. Балансировщик разделяет поступающие обращения между машинами. Каждый узел обрабатывает долю потока. Вертикальное масштабирование наращивает производительность оборудования.

Группы работают как общая архитектура и обеспечивают стабильность. При сбое одной сервера остальные продолжают поддерживать клиентов. Корректная архитектура обеспечивает обрабатывать растущий трафик без падения качества.

Распределение загрузки

Балансировка запросов между множеством узлами 1вин казино предотвращает избыточность архитектуры. Балансировщик оценивает актуальную нагрузку серверов и отправляет трафик на менее свободные узлы. Динамическое добавление машин случается при увеличении количества пользователей. Платформа расширяется в соответствии от фактической необходимости в вычислительных средствах.

Кэширование и разделение обращений

Буфер сохраняет часто запрашиваемые данные в оперативной ОЗУ. Вторичные обращения к данным не требуют обращений к базе. Распределенный кэш находится на множестве машинах для увеличения объема. CDN предоставляет фиксированный материал из близких к клиенту серверов. Такие способы снижают нагрузку на основную архитектуру и увеличивают отклик платформы.

Безопасность сведений: оборона, дублирующие дубликаты и управление допуска

Оборона информации нуждается всестороннего подхода на всех уровнях платформы. Шифрование данных исключает неразрешённый доступ при прослушивании потока. Механизмы безопасности 1вин гарантируют секретность отправки данных.

Механизм контроля допуска сдерживает права пользователей в зависимости от роли. Аутентификация контролирует достоверность пользовательских записей. Периодическое формирование дублирующих копий защищает от потери информации при сбоях.

Дубликаты находятся на независимых узлах или в удалённых хранилищах. Автоматизированное резервирование осуществляется по плану. Процедуры восстановления позволяют моментально вернуть дееспособность архитектуры.

Что происходит при отказах и как системы восстанавливаются

Системные отказы возникают по различным основаниям: поломка техники, ошибки приложений, переполнение сети. Системы наблюдения контролируют статус компонентов и оповещают о сбоях. Программные системы активируют операции реанимации.

Основные стадии реанимации дееспособности:

  • Определение сбоя через мониторинг
  • Переключение трафика на резервные машины
  • Восстановление данных из копий
  • Исправление сбоя

Репликация информации на несколько узлов обеспечивает постоянство работы. При поломке отдельного сервера архитектура задействует запасные копии. Длительность восстановления определяется от структуры архитектуры.

Почему базы данных и машины остаются основой электронного окружения

Любой современный электронный сервис нуждается надежного содержания и выполнения информации. Серверы 1win casino выполняют вычисления и координируют деятельность программ. Хранилища данных предоставляют быстрый доступ к данным. Эволюция технологий не исключает основополагающие правила архитектуры. Осознание устройства архитектуры способствует разрабатывать эффективные и гибкие решения.

Facebook
Twitter
Email
Print

Leave a Reply

Your email address will not be published. Required fields are marked *

Related Article

Как работают хранилища данных и машины

Как работают хранилища данных и машины Нынешние цифровые сервисы работают благодаря связи двух основных частей. Машины обрабатывают обращения пользователей и осуществляют расчеты. Хранилища данных хранят

Как действуют виртуальные машины

Как действуют виртуальные машины Виртуальная машина является собой софтверную среду, которая моделирует физический компьютер. Технология дает возможность выполнять множество операционных систем на одном реальном сервере

Как работают платформы авторизации пользователей

Как работают платформы авторизации пользователей Инструменты разрешения пользователей находятся среди основе основной-части цифровых ресурсов. Такие-системы определяют, какие функции доступны человеку по-окончании авторизации во профиль: просмотр